Job Description:

The Private Client Relationship Manager II (RM) is a high-touch point of client contact accountable to serve the unique and complex needs of clients in the high net worth segment. The Private Client Relationship Manager II will serve as the central point of contact for HNW clients across banking lending and High Net Worth Investing with expertise in banking and lending. The job partners with Investment Advisors and Trust Advisors to provide proactive client service to achieve greater share of wallet. The job will also be responsible for retaining and growing the client relationship and is accountable for exceeding clients expectations for asset accumulation, preservation and growth. The Private Client Relationship Manager II is at the center of the Private Client Services model supporting an integrated Wealth Management offering by providing day-to-day account management, wealth management solutions (via partner referrals) and complex credit solutions for client and their businesses. In so doing, the Private Client Relationship Manager II must focus on maximizing clients satisfaction with their Banking relationships, maximizing profitability of the portfolio, while ensuring minimum credit risk for Bank funds.

OCC Language:

  • This position falls within the definition of Loan Originator as defined under Regulation Z of the Truth in Lending Act, 12 CFR Part 1026.36; and the definition of Mortgage Loan Originator as defined under the Secure and Fair Enforcement for Mortgage Licensing Act of 2008 (SAFE Act), 12 U.S.C. §§ 5102 et seq., and its implementing regulations, 12 CFR Part 1007; and is with a FINRA member, broker or dealer and is subject to the requirements of FINRA and Securities Laws.  May (or may not) be a registered position under FINRA
  • Must be eligible for employment with a covered financial institution under the standards established by Regulation Z of the Truth in Lending Act, 12 CFR Part 1026.36
  • Must be eligible for registration as a registered mortgage loan originator with the NMLS (Nationwide Mortgage Licensing System and Registry) in accordance with the Secure and Fair Enforcement for Mortgage Licensing Act of 2008 (SAFE Act), 12 U.S.C. §§ 5102 et seq., and its implementing regulations, 12 CFR Part 1007
  • Must be eligible for employment under standards established by FINRA.  Subject to the investigation and verification requirements of FINRA Rule 3110(e), including:  the Firm's obligation to investigate the good character, business reputation, qualifications and experience of an applicant for registration before applying to register the applicant with FINRA and filing the applicant's Form U4 with the CRD, and before representing on the applicant's Form U4 that it has conducted this investigation and verified the accuracy and completeness of the information contained in the applicant's Form U4; and the Firm's obligation to verify the accuracy and completeness of the information contained on the applicant’s Form U4, no later than 30 calendar days after the Form U4 is filed with FINRA
  • Satisfactory results on a criminal background check, credit report check, civil litigation search, and regulatory agency or self-regulatory organization enforcement action search, and statements/certification from job applicant regarding administrative, civil, or criminal findings by any government agency/authority or self-regulatory organization, are required by federal law for this position
